Digital Gaming Network Acquires Poker Software Firm Dobrosoft

Digital Gaming Network has acquired the assets of Gibraltar-based poker software firm, Dobrosoft.

Owners of Dobrosoft are set to transfer management over to the new DGN management team within the next 90 days. Some of Dobrosoft's existing workers will be retained by the new management, specifically the rank and file software staff.

DGN has already made an aggressive bid to strengthen the company by hiring several online poker industry executives and IT managers. However, the terms of sale were not disclosed.

According to Vinko Dobrosevic, CEO and Transitioning Founder of Dobrosoft, "The company looks forward to having the additional resources and expertise that DGN can bring to the table to help the company grow in ways that can fulfill its longtime potential".

Dobrosevic further stated, "I am pleased to announce the sale to Digital Gaming Network. The new company will have the talent and experience to launch a new era for itself and its employees. Industry insiders will be taking notice very soon."

As Nicole Sims, DGN's spokesperson stated, "Dobrosoft's core software platform and untapped market potential is a cornerstone of our efforts in creating a leading alternative to existing multi-player software networks".

Furthermore, Sims explained, "We have already invested heavily in operational infrastructure and upgrades to the products scalability. We will be working diligently to continue to build on this base and to take the product to a whole new level."
